Output 5325b26841aa8fa555baf4bc804d64ca17f62cdfd992269ccc5c15dc8de25d6e:0

value
12684900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 df192cc9a042baec39798a576003e9fa118702c1 OP_EQUALVERIFY OP_CHECKSIG
address
1MLdqxwXNyXpsidHhTrFYgCpBrYWY8MfVf
transaction
5325b26841aa8fa555baf4bc804d64ca17f62cdfd992269ccc5c15dc8de25d6e
confirmations
387985
spent
true